Installation
1. Choose a location near leak-prone, hard-to-reach areas.
NOTE: Depending on temperature and humidity, the rope sensor may take up to 60 minutes to dry after water contact.

2. (Optional) Install the mounting bracket on the floor or wall with the included screws or adhesive backing.

Learn more about Adhesive installation instructions for Ring Alarm Sensors.
On drywall, stucco, brick, or concrete, use a 3/16 (5 mm) masonry bit to drill holes for the included wall anchors.

3. Attach your monitor to the mounting bracket by sliding until you hear a click to secure.
NOTE: Ensure the monitor is pointing up.

4. Insert the included cable into the hole on the mounting bracket.

5. Route the other end of the cable over the area where you want to detect water, like a sump pump basin.
CAUTION!
Do not submerge the main unit or mounting bracket in any liquid.
